Output 58a81c7c8b0b4aaf4e3ec5489f9bb392161e02b023ec79f0184bfbbf666b4cd7:0

value
16530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03cee4d878fe3d045f8e556ff65fe4eac7bd67e OP_EQUAL
address
3PbH68jZCKxYB38wR7Wwg63Gc3PMehnmCw
transaction
58a81c7c8b0b4aaf4e3ec5489f9bb392161e02b023ec79f0184bfbbf666b4cd7
spent
true